Permalink
Commits on Jan 10, 2019
  1. Add TLS to Fleetautoscaler webhook service

    aLekSer authored and markmandel committed Jan 2, 2019
    Add TLS CA Bundle verification if HTTPS scheme is used. Environment
    variables to configure main scaling parameters. Now both HTTP and HTTPS
    webhook servers could be used simultaneously in different
    fleetautoscalers.
    Add tutorial on using HTTPS webhook fleetautoscaler.
Commits on Dec 31, 2018
  1. Add webhook functionality into FleetAutoscaler

    aLekSer authored and markmandel committed Dec 18, 2018
    Add webhook policy type into FleetAutoscaler declaration.
    Provided an example of a webhook pod which receives FleetAutoscaleReview
    with a Fleet status and based on that information calculates target
    replica set. This process is performed on FleetAustoscaler Sync every 30
    seconds. Extends Buffer policy functionality with Webhook policy which is proposed in #334 comments.
Commits on Dec 26, 2018
  1. Apply fix for goroutines leak

    aLekSer authored and markmandel committed Dec 26, 2018
    Fixes #414 CPU leak.
    Fix is proposed by next pull request, which have not merged yet.
    https://github.com/kubernetes/kubernetes/pull/70277/files
Commits on Dec 8, 2018
  1. Add test - no allocations possible in a used fleet

    aLekSer authored and markmandel committed Dec 7, 2018
    Simple test which checks that we are able to add not more than
    Replica count of gameservers per one fleet.
  2. Add short=7 git attribute which used in VERSION

    aLekSer authored and markmandel committed Dec 7, 2018
    The docker images which are stored in docker registry currently has
    format with hash of size 7 for instanse:
    agones-controller:0.7.0-5e2ad5e
    So on some platforms this git rev-parse command could results in 8 hex
    symbols.